Mitigating Risk and Driving Positive Impact: A Framework for Responsible Procurement

Effective procurement practices extend beyond simply acquiring goods and services at the lowest cost. To drive positive impact while mitigating risks, organizations must embrace a framework that integrates ethical considerations, environmental sustainability, and social responsibility. This involves carefully assessing suppliers based on their stances to fair labor practices, environmental protection, and human rights. By fostering transparent connections with suppliers, organizations can promote accountability and ensure that procurement decisions align with their core values. Furthermore, prioritizing local sourcing and supporting small businesses can contribute to economic development and community well-being.

A responsible procurement framework also encompasses robust risk management strategies. Conducting thorough due diligence on potential suppliers, evaluating their financial stability and operational practices, is crucial for minimizing the likelihood of supply chain disruptions or reputational damage. Implementing clear ethical guidelines and performance metrics for suppliers can further strengthen accountability and promote continuous improvement.

  • Similarly, embracing responsible procurement practices not only minimizes risks but also unlocks a range of opportunities. By aligning with sustainable and ethical principles, organizations can enhance their brand reputation, attract and retain talent, and foster stronger relationships with stakeholders.
